Hypermagnesemia

Elevated magnesium levels in the blood above the normal range (>1.1-1.3 mmol/L). Can be caused by excessive intake of magnesium supplements, especially with kidney failure. Manifests as muscle weakness, decreased reflexes, hypotension, nausea, heart rhythm disturbances, and in severe cases - respiratory depression and cardiac arrest.
